Rent vs. Buy in Irion County, TX

Should you rent or buy in Irion County? Here are the numbers.

Median Home Price

$149,600

Median Rent

$1,145/mo

Price-to-Rent Ratio

10.9x

Homeownership Rate

88.3%

Monthly Cost Comparison

Buying (20% down, 6.5% rate)

Mortgage (P&I)$756
Property Tax$127
Insurance$50

Total Monthly$933

Renting

Monthly Rent$1,145
Renter's Insurance$25

Total Monthly$1,170

In Irion County, buying is approximately $212/mo cheaper than renting (before equity buildup and tax benefits).

About Irion County, Texas

Irion County in Texas has a median household income of $54,708 and an effective property tax rate of 1.0%. With a price-to-rent ratio of 10.9x, buying is likely more cost-effective for long-term residents.
